Please I need some help!
Schach [20]

(f+g)(x) = 8x+2

(f-g)(x) = 4x-6

Step-by-step explanation:

Given

f(x) =6x-2\\g(x)=2x+4

we have to find

<u>a. (f+g)(x)</u>

(f+g)(x)=f(x)+g(x)\\=(6x-2)+(2x+4)\\=6x-2+2x+4\\=6x+2x-2+4\\=8x+2

<u>b. (f-g)(x)</u>

(f-g)(x)=f(x)-g(x)\\=(6x-2)-(2x+4)\\=6x-2-2x-4\\=6x-2x-2-4\\=4x-6

Hence,

(f+g)(x) = 8x+2

(f-g)(x) = 4x-6
